In Taminad housing board, I had purchased a house. In the year 2004 I went to the office and was ready to pay the full settllement of my account ( orally ofcourse). In the office they told that I had to pay Rs 6875 and accordingly I paid the sum.
Now in the year 2009, a notice has been served that I had to pay Rs 20000.
What I want is the complete account details of the same.
Can I get the details from the board using Right to know information act? If so what is the procedure. Thanking you the expers.
Raj Kumar Makkad (Expert) 14 October 2009
It is very simple. Move a simple application seeking specific information with your complete address. Deposit required fee (generally Rs. 10?-) with the application and submit it to the concerned office addressing Assistance Public Information Officer of Housing Board of concerned city. Rest is upon that officer and he is bound to provide information within 30 days of application and if documents are more than one then he can also seek additional amount to be deposited within 7 days of the receipt of the application which you have to deposit within 15 days of receipt of such letter.
